                    Standard Harp Models

 After building all custom one-of-a-kind harps for the last 28 years, I have launched a new line of standard model  harps.

These standard production models  have all the attention to detail that my custom harps have always had, offering what harp players most desire in a fine quality harp.

My new harps come in two sizes, with 29 and 36 natural notes, but as single, double or cross-strung versions. The note ranges are both C to C, starting at First octave C.

The string spacing and tension are a generous standard  that is comfortable to most harp players, no matter if they play a folk harp, or a pedal harp.  I am offering them with either nylon or folk harp gut strings. Lever Gut is not quite as tight in tension as concert gut, but will feel quite good even to the full time pedal harpist. Levers are Loveland or Camac, with Truitt levers at extra cost.

All the sound boxes are staved backed, with solid Spruce soundboards. Many harp builders are using veneers on their soundboards, but I will never do so, as the cross-grained wood tends to flatten the richness of the sound. I am offering these new harps in Myrtle wood, Maple, Cherry, Walnut, and Koa wood.

My 36-string single string band model weighs in at about 19 to 22 lbs, depending on which wood is used. The height at the maximum point is 57 inches. the 29 string size is also very light weight.  And so all of these new harp models are both compact and very lightweight.
